\( 1 \leftarrow \) Complete parts a) and b). a) If \( 30 \% \) of a number is 60 , is the number greater than or less than 60 ? Explain. b) If \( 150 \% \) of a number is 60 , is the number greater than or less than 60 ? Explain.

Solution
a) Given that \( 30\% \) of a number \( x \) is 60, we write the equation as:
\[
0.30x = 60
\]
To solve for \( x \), divide both sides of the equation by \( 0.30 \):
\[
x = \frac{60}{0.30} = 200
\]
Since \( 200 > 60 \), the number is greater than 60.
b) Given that \( 150\% \) of a number \( x \) is 60, we write the equation as:
\[
1.50x = 60
\]
To solve for \( x \), divide both sides by \( 1.50 \):
\[
x = \frac{60}{1.50} = 40
\]
Since \( 40 < 60 \), the number is less than 60.
